Generally caused by clouds changing the sunlight. I've already set "cancel shadows" and tried to require motion but still getting a good 10 or so of these a day.

I'm thinking the next thing to try is increasing contrast up a lot and making a new profile for night vision as I'm currently missing triggers with people at night, but any other suggestions on handling this?

I suggest setting up 2 more zones: Zone B and Zone C. You can have zone B covering the top left portion of the driveway and Zone C covering the bottom portion. Make sure these two zones (b and c) do not overlap. Then in object detection create a rule "B-C, C-B"

This means it will only trigger when an object crosses from zone b to c or visa versa.

One last thing to try it the "reset detector when" setting. Try changing this to a lower number like 30%. If you think about it a person walking down the driveway will probably only account for 10-15% change in the picture. Having a 30% reset might greatly reduce the false triggers.... Also a 2 second make time in my opinion is very high. You will miss important alerts and events if this is set too high or you will miss things leading up to the trigger:
